USC Trojans at Notre Dame Fighting Irish betting odds on NBC Saturday

USC-at-Notre-Dame-Odds16.jpg

For the second time in three years USC heads into its game with Notre Dame led by an interim head coach. Clay Helton takes over for the fired Steve Sarkisian as the Trojans enter yet another chaotic period. While the headlines have surrounded the USC program, the Irish continue to be in the mix for the College Football Playoff thanks to a perfect 4-0 SU and ATS home record.

ODDS

Notre Dame opened as a 4-point favorite with the total at 61. The Irish received plenty of play following news of SC’s coaching change, pushing the line to -6.5. USC is an underdog for the first time this season looking to improve on its 3-2 ATS record. Under bettors love seeing the Trojans hit the road. USC has played below the total in each of its last five away games.

KEY MISMATCH

The Trojans have the better quarterback in Cody Kessler, who will be looking to bounce back and provide more leadership after a rough outing. He was on the fringe of the Heisman discussion until the loss to Washington. He threw two early interceptions, which helped set the tone for the upset loss, and was sacked five times, yet he still ranks fourth nationally in passing efficiency with a rating of 179.2. Kessler threw six touchdown passes in last season’s 49-14 win over the Irish, but this Notre Dame defense is a lot healthier and much more stout than last year’s version. Plus the Trojans will be without Max Tuerk, who’s done for the year following a knee injury. His loss means trouble for Kessler and the rest of the front line, since the center was the leader of that group. The Irish front seven, particularly Sheldon Day and Jaylon Smith, will routinely break through and disrupt the USC backfield. And if last week told us anything, it’s that the Trojans’ offense is neutralized when there is traffic in the backfield.

KEY STAT

238.8 – Notre Dame’s rushing yards per game to rank 13th in the FBS. USC’s inconsistent defense has allowed 182 or more yards on the ground in three of its five games.

BETTING ANGLE

Southern Cal opened the season well enough, racking up 114 points in two easy cupcake wins. But the downhill slide began right after that with a loss to Stanford. Sarkisian was fired on Monday following allegations of alcohol abuse, overshadowing a stunning loss to Washington, the Trojans’ second straight defeat at home. USC looks like a team in disarray at the moment. The Trojans were supposed to contend for not only a Pac-12 championship this season, but also for a spot in the College Football Playoff. Instead they can’t seem to get out of their own way, and bettors can’t be sure which USC will show up. The smart choice in this spot is with Notre Dame, playing at home against a manageable spread. However, USC still has the talent and the turmoil over their former coach could be a galvanizing moment.

ANALYSIS AND PREDICTION

While it’s easy to write USC off after the latest turbulence surrounding the program, Kessler and many of his teammates already learned how to adjust to a coaching change the first three times it happened during the past two seasons. And remember, talent isn’t the issue with USC. The quarterback will respond in a rivalry game and receiver JuJu Smith-Schuster and backs Tre Madden and Ronald Jones II are all playmakers for an offense looking for redemption after last week’s disaster. Justin Wilcox’s defense has evolved into a solid mix of veterans and blue-chip underclassmen that allows less than four yards per carry and is capable of slowing down Irish workhorse C.J. Prosise. The Trojans have allowed just one touchdown pass and slightly better than 50 percent of pass attempts to be completed over the last two games. Notre Dame quarterback DeShone Kizer has been steady since taking over, but spectacular moments have been rare. The Trojans will rally with the odds stacked against them and leave South Bend with a victory over the stunned Irish.

USC 31, Notre Dame 26
